1. PRESENT
1.1. Continuous
1.1.1. +You are watching TV
1.1.2. ?Are you watching TV?
1.1.3. -You aren't watching TV
1.2. Simple
1.2.1. +I talk.
1.2.2. ?Do you talk?
1.2.3. -I don't talk.
1.3. Perfect
1.3.1. +You have seen that movie many times
1.3.2. ?Have you seen that movie many times?
1.3.3. -You haven't seen that movie many times.
